Guidelines for tack and attire appointments for the WHS Corinthian Class
Appointments are important. Here are some guidelines. For a complete list you can refer to The Chronicle of the Horse Appointments.
- Flat bridle with no rubber on reins 
- Flat breastplate 
- Spurs for call back, can leave off over fences 
- No saddle pad for call back, can use over fences 
- Black dress boots, have boots straps to match boots, either flat black for patent leather or brown for men 
- White string gloves under saddle flaps, fingers forward, wear brown gloves 
- Adults carry hunt whip, children optional 
- Sandwich case for ladies and children with proper sandwich in wax paper and sherry or port for women and tea for children; men carry flask 
- Approved plain helmet or top hat, women wear hairnet 
- If staff have wire cutters, no sandwich case
